NRL Live Predictions - Round 19

July 17th 2008 01:36
Category: Weekly Tips


North Queensland Cowboys ($5.00) v Brisbane Broncos ($1.15)

Believe it or not, the season has gone from bad to worse for the Cowboys with the news that captain Johnathan Thurston will miss a month due to injury. The Broncos went down to the Bulldogs in a massive upset but I’m confident that they’ll bounce back in Townsville. NQ will play tough and gritty footy but they simply don’t have the strikepower to score points with Thurston on the sidelines. Broncos to win by 1-12.

Manly Sea Eagles ($1.22) v Parramatta Eels ($4.00)

Manly were clinical in their demolition of the Sharks last weekend and head into this clash with the underperforming Eels as heavy favourites. However, despite their recent poor form, adversity can often bring the best out in teams and I think Parramatta will be determined to give Manly a run for their money. I can’t tip against the Sea Eagles but it will be tight.

Gold Coast Titans ($1.90) v Penrith Panthers ($1.90)

This game is the definition of 50/50. The Titans caused the upset of the season with a gritty win over the Roosters, while Penrith were disappointing in their loss to the Knights. Although the Panthers have the better team on paper I believe the Gold Coast have the edge when it comes to motivation, belief and tactics. Add in a parochial home crowd and the Titans should win.

Cronulla Sharks ($1.50) v Newcastle Knights ($2.50)

Another tough one to pick. Cronulla will be desperate to show that last week’s poor performance against Manly was just a one off. On the other hand the Knights would have gained great confidence from their victory over Penrith. One player to watch for the Knights is fullback Kurt Gidley, who gives 100% every minute of every match. But overall I think the Sharks will prove too strong.

Canterbury Bulldogs ($1.70) v New Zealand Warriors ($2.10)

The Bulldogs upset the Broncos and will be full of enthusiasm going into this contest against the Warriors, who disposed of the Cowboys last round. Traditionally, the Warriors struggle to win away from home but I can see them playing well on Saturday. Warriors to grab the two points and continue their push for the top eight.

Canberra Raiders ($2.35) v Sydney Roosters ($1.55)

Canberra shocked the Dragons last weekend and if the Roosters have any thoughts of complacency they’ll face the same fate. However, I think Sydney will be focused, knowing that a win is required to remain near the top of the ladder. Canberra are usually very tough at home but the Roosters have enough experience to tough it out.

South Sydney Rabbitohs ($1.80) v Wests Tigers ($2.00)

Yet another tantalising match-up in a weekend that looks set to be characterised by close encounters. Remarkably, Souths are shooting for their sixth consecutive win, while the Tigers will be looking to build on Monday night’s impressive showing against the Storm. If the Bunnies forwards can trample the Wests’ pack, then the likes of Wing, Isaac Luke and Chris Sandow will prove too hot to handle. Rabbitohs to win (again!).

Melbourne Storm ($1.18) v St. George Illawarra Dragons ($4.50)

Greg Inglis inspired the Storm to victory last weekend and I can’t wait to see him take on the Dragons. St. George were woeful against the Raiders and it remains to be seen whether the fuss surrounding Mark Gasnier will destabilise or galvanise the team. It’s impossible to tip against the Storm at home but the Dragons’ backline may pose a few problems for the Storm defence.

I picked 4/8 last weekend (50%). My overall tally for the season stands at 74/128 (58%).
